Four walls of the inguinal canal
- Anterior wall: external oblique aponeurosis throughout; internal oblique reinforces laterally
- Posterior wall: transversalis fascia throughout; conjoint tendon (IA + TA) reinforces medially
- Roof (superior wall): arching fibres of internal oblique + transversus abdominis
- Floor (inferior wall): inguinal ligament + lacunar ligament medially
Rings
- Deep inguinal ring: opening in transversalis fascia, midpoint of inguinal ligament, 1.25 cm above ligament, lateral to inferior epigastric artery
- Superficial inguinal ring: V-shaped defect in external oblique aponeurosis, above and lateral to pubic tubercle
Contents — Male
Spermatic cord: (1) vas deferens, (2) testicular artery, (3) pampiniform venous plexus, (4) cremasteric artery, (5) artery to vas, (6) lymphatics, (7) sympathetic fibres, (8) genital branch of genitofemoral nerve. Plus the ilioinguinal nerve (lies on spermatic cord, not within).
Contents — Female
Round ligament of the uterus (homologue of gubernaculum) + ilioinguinal nerve. No spermatic cord.
Indirect vs Direct hernia
- Indirect: enters through deep ring (lateral to inferior epigastric artery), passes through entire canal, exits superficial ring into scrotum. Covered by all three layers of spermatic cord coverings. Controlled by occluding the deep ring. Younger patients, congenital (patent processus vaginalis). Risk of strangulation higher.
- Direct: pushes through posterior wall (Hesselbach's triangle), medial to inferior epigastric artery. NOT controlled by occluding deep ring. Older patients, acquired (weakness). Rarely strangulates. Reduces spontaneously in supine position.

SITS — four rotator cuff muscles
- Supraspinatus: Origin = supraspinous fossa; Insertion = superior facet of greater tubercle; Action = abduction (0–15°), humeral head depression; Nerve = suprascapular (C4–C6)
- Infraspinatus: Origin = infraspinous fossa; Insertion = middle facet of greater tubercle; Action = lateral rotation; Nerve = suprascapular (C5–C6)
- Teres minor: Origin = lateral border of scapula; Insertion = inferior facet of greater tubercle; Action = lateral rotation; Nerve = axillary (C5–C6)
- Subscapularis: Origin = subscapular fossa; Insertion = lesser tubercle; Action = medial rotation, adduction; Nerve = upper + lower subscapular (C5–C7)
Supraspinatus tear — clinical features
- Painful arc: 60–120° abduction (impingement under coracoacromial arch)
- Unable to initiate abduction from 0° (supraspinatus initiates first 15°)
- Drop arm test positive: inability to maintain 90° abduction against gravity
- Empty can (Jobe's) test: pain/weakness in scapular plane with thumb pointing down
- Chronic: cuff tear arthropathy with superior migration of humeral head on X-ray
Investigations
- X-ray: normal or superior head migration; acromial spur
- Ultrasound: first-line dynamic assessment of cuff tendons
- MRI: gold standard for full-thickness vs partial-thickness tear, extent, retraction
- MR arthrogram: for labral tears / SLAP lesions if also needed
Levator ani — three parts
- Puborectalis: Origin = posterior surface of pubic body; loops behind the anorectal junction (not inserting into coccyx); forms the anorectal sling maintaining the anorectal angle (~80–90°). Tonic contraction = continence. Relaxation = straightening of angle during defaecation.
- Pubococcygeus: Pubic body → anococcygeal raphe + coccyx. Supports bladder, vagina, rectum.
- Iliococcygeus: Tendinous arch → coccyx. Broadest part; like a hammock.
Nerve supply
Nerve to levator ani (S3/S4 direct branches from sacral plexus on superior/pelvic surface) + perineal branch of pudendal nerve (inferior surface).
Puborectalis in faecal continence
Puborectalis maintains the anorectal angle at ~90° by its sling-like tonic pull, creating a mechanical valve. During defaecation, puborectalis relaxes (angle straightens to ~130°). The internal anal sphincter provides resting pressure; the external anal sphincter provides voluntary squeeze. All three act together for continence.
Damage consequences
- Puborectalis denervation/damage (obstetric injury, sphincterotomy) → loss of anorectal angle → faecal incontinence
- Levator ani damage in childbirth → pelvic organ prolapse (cystocoele, rectocoele, uterine prolapse)
Median nerve intrinsic muscles (LOAF)
- Lateral two lumbricals (1st and 2nd): arise from radial side of FDP tendons of index and middle fingers; insert into extensor expansion; flex MCPJs + extend IPJs. Nerve: palmar digital branches of median nerve.
- Opponens pollicis: deepest thenar muscle; origin = flexor retinaculum + trapezium; insertion = radial border of 1st metacarpal shaft. Action: opposition (rotation + flexion + medial rotation of 1st metacarpal). Key for pinch.
- Abductor pollicis brevis: most superficial; abducts thumb at MCPj in palmar plane.
- Flexor pollicis brevis: superficial head = median nerve; deep head = ulnar nerve. Flexes thumb at MCPJ.
Signs of median nerve palsy at the wrist (CTS / wrist laceration)
- Sensory loss: palmar surface of radial 3½ digits (thumb, index, middle, radial half of ring) + dorsal fingertips
- Thenar wasting: opponens + APB + FPB atrophy → flat thenar eminence
- Loss of opposition: cannot bring thumb to face little finger pad-to-pad (ape hand deformity)
- Weak pinch: cannot form the “OK” circle (if AIN also involved)
- LOAF wasting; ring/little clawing NOT severe (FDP to ring/little = ulnar; lateral 2 lumbricals lost but medial 2 intact)
